Bike Rack Saves Pedestrians in Crash in Brooklyn

calendar-icon
accident photo

Source: Photo Accident.biz

A New Jersey driver with a history of reckless behavior on New York City streets crashed onto a Brooklyn sidewalk on Monday morning. The out-of-control vehicle finally stopped after hitting a bike rack, StreetsBlogNYC reports.

 

According to one witness, the driver jumped the curb on Kings Highway between E. 17th and 18th streets around 9 a.m. The bike rack bent but did not break, preventing further potential harm.
 

Both a witness and the NYPD confirmed that no one was seriously injured in the incident.
 

"Enough is enough!" said Amber Adler, an activist, Council candidate, and member of Families for Safe Streets, who was present at the scene. "If it weren’t for the bike rack outside a local grocer, at least half a dozen people could have been injured or killed this morning. We live in a pedestrian-filled city. We need more bike racks."
 

Adler also called for the installation of multiple bike racks in sequence to act as a barrier and protect New Yorkers from reckless drivers.
 

City records indicate that the white Hyundai involved in the crash had been caught 10 times by speed and red-light cameras since October 10, 2023.
